The colloquium was joint organised by UKM’s IKON (Institute of Occidental Studies), Social Institute Malaysia (ISM) and Stockholm University.
On the first day of the colloquium, five papers was presented from distinguish researcher from UKM, Stockholm University and Aalborg University. Most of the papers interestingly talked about the welfare systems and women roles in Nordic countries.
Later that evening, we had official conference dinner with dinner talk by Dato’ Seri Shahrizat Jalil, Minister for Women, Family and Community Development.
On the second day, we had another five papers presented by speakers from UKM, Stockholm University and Helsinki University. Overall, the 1st Nordic studies colloquium was quite interesting. There was also talks and initiatives about student exchange programme collaboration between UKM and Nordic Universities. Anyone interested to learn Finnish?
